Unlocking the Possibilities of Tissue Culture for Sagwan Growth

Tissue culture presents a transformative approach to improving sagwan cultivation. This technique, involving the manipulation of plant cells in a sterile environment, offers several benefits over traditional approaches.

Firstly, tissue culture allows for the rapid creation of large numbers of sagwan saplings within a small space. This efficiency can significantly reduce the time and resources required for establishing sagwan plantations.

Secondly, tissue culture enables the multiplication of elite sagwan clones with desirable characteristics, such as high productivity or resistance to infections. This improvement process can lead to the development of optimized sagwan cultivars that contribute to increased woodland productivity.

Furthermore, tissue culture reduces the risk of introducing diseases into sagwan plantations, as the process occurs in a controlled environment. This protection can help ensure the viability of sagwan trees and promote sustainable agriculture practices.

Harnessing the Power of Tissue Culture for Sagwan Propagation

Tissue culture presents a novel approach to cultivate Sagwan trees, offering several benefits. This technique facilitates the production of numerous saplings from a few number of explants in a controlled laboratory environment. By harnessing the inherent developmental potential of Sagwan tissue, we can create genetically alike offspring that possess the desirable characteristics of the parent plant.

This method presents immense opportunity for sustainable Sagwan propagation, contributing in the conservation and development of this valuable tree species.
